Ticket: DEDUP-412 — Connection failures during customer record dedup

The Larkspur dedup job started failing overnight with pool exhaustion errors. It merges duplicate customer records in batches of 500, but the batch worker isn't releasing connections after a merge conflict, so the pool drains within twenty minutes. Proposed fix: wrap merges in a try/finally release and cap retries at three. For the sync, reproduce against staging using the connection string below.

primary connection of bagep-kaweg = clickhouse://rusdor_svc:3TXlgH7O8DuUYI@db-ae3f.zarqelgrid.internal:5432/zordor

**Q: How does Puzzlewright decide which clues to keep when a grid fails validation?**

The generator scores each clue-answer pair and discards the lowest-ranked entries first, then refills from the themed lexicon. If you see repeated fill failures, it usually means the theme entries are too constrained. Retry limits and scoring weights are configurable per puzzle. Configuration details are on the internal page below.

runbook for badug-kadup: https://confluence.zemvarlabs.internal/projects/browse/display/projects/bd1b

Runbook: AgriLink Gateway rollout. Before promoting a new firmware bundle to the Harvestwell fleet, confirm the telemetry gateway drains its queue to the Silowatch backend and that CAN-bus adapters re-register within 90 seconds of restart. If any tractor node stays dark past two polling cycles, halt the rollout. The build token for the staging cut appears below.

pipeline stamp: htk3_69f

# Build Provenance: Vendored Fonts

All third-party fonts used in Quillmark builds are vendored under `vendor/fonts/`. No network fetches at build time. Each font's license and upstream checksum are recorded in the manifest; CI fails on mismatch. Updates require a signed review from the Lanternworks security rotation. Reproducibility verified weekly against a clean builder. The current manifest was produced by the build identified below.

pipeline stamp: htk9_ce63042d9